Transaction ab576e1abce83f0048c23f08d8440c01deb2a37fcaaf943650e1ea070f291d11
2 Input
1 Outputs
- ab576e1abce83f0048c23f08d8440c01deb2a37fcaaf943650e1ea070f291d11:0
value 99756952
address 176FWYfi1fKMLjgZTFv6qT7evfr35Ztxm3